Output 32046557752f85f6a47e415fabbfbe6c205aa2d18d29de133fca6d29b74f4f3e:1

value
150000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f89c7ea876a696b73c83db9663bcc5292b49d6d6 OP_EQUAL
address
3QMYyZfvZktdACUrVoZVdHCRZczsoqAafL
transaction
32046557752f85f6a47e415fabbfbe6c205aa2d18d29de133fca6d29b74f4f3e
spent
true